Not long ago I had a fascinating conversation with a few homeschool parents of middle school age children who are in the process of making programs for high school. In the process, they elevated quite a few questions that I think many other parents also question.
Since these parents know me as their youngster?s science instructor, our discussion naturally centered on technology training. Fundamentally, we were talking about 2 things. First, what does a good, high school technology education contain? And 2nd, what do colleges want to see?
Science is such a broad topic which it isn?t at all obvious what subjects students ought to study. Of course, a year each of biology, chemistry, and physics is conventional, but why? Why isn?t Planet science, which deals with some of the most crucial issues of our day time, including climate, part of that core curriculum? Is it ok to exchange more specialized courses such as astronomy, botany, or ?forensics? for the more traditional classes? Should scholars study just the branches of scientific disciplines that they most take pleasure in?
There?s no crystal clear response to these queries; the results that people come to will have as much to do with ideas and tastes as they will with details. Individually, I think that while biology, chemistry, and physics are all great, Earth science is simply as good and needs to be in the spot light more than it is. I believe it gets short shrift due to the far-reaching impact of medical schools, which all call for candidates to take the field of biology, chemistry, and physics, but not Earth research. In my opinion, relatively broad survey programs should make up the better portion of secondary school science, but adding in one or two specialised lessons can be amazing, particularly if they are in add-on to the more general sessions. If specialized classes replace too many broad survey courses, my problem is that students will not get enough background information to come up with a precise picture of the way the world works.
Even though it?s undoubtedly possible for students to get an excellent high school science education in very non-traditional methods, that technique is risky. Some schools, especially little liberal arts schools, would unquestionably look on unusual programs of study kindly, but most schools will wish to see SAT Subject Exams and AP Exams. In Ny State, Regents exams might also be essential. Notably, many of the colleges most likely to de-emphasize standardized exams are extremely expensive, so unless cash is not an issue, it makes lots of feeling to work difficult to get some strong check scores. This is especially essential for homeschoolers, who probably need to take at least 5 SAT Topic exams if they plan to apply to selective schools. Therefore, it?s necessary to consist of, and probably emphasize, classes which will allow college students shine on these tests. The only three SAT Subject exams in science are biology, chemistry, and physics. Doing well on AP exams is also a dependable method to impress colleges, so these tests should be taken under consideration as well. There are AP exams in biology, chemistry, physics, and environmental science. Regents, which may be essential in New york State (and especially for SUNY and CUNY schools), offer tests in biology (known as Living Environment), chemistry, physics, and Earth science.
The mothers and fathers that I?d my recent discussion with have daughters who?re strongly biased in the direction of the humanities. They like science, but they like English and background more. They do well in math, but they don?t get much enjoyment from it. With this in thoughts, they are presently thinking about a two-year program of Earth science for 8th and 9th grades that will permit the women to consider the Earth science regents at the finish of 9th quality, a two-year biology program that will permit the women to take the SAT Topic Check in Biology at the end of 11th grade (and the Living Environment Regents Exam, for all those of them who will be applying to SUNY or CUNY schools), and an one year conceptual physics course in 12th grade that will not be connected with any standardized check. Chemistry is notably absent from this routine simply because it isn?t secure to complete high school chemistry in the house. Ideally, a minimum of some of the kids will take a chemistry class in community college or in a college that allows homeschoolers to take courses a la mappemonde.
